
SUITLAND, Md. – The Prince George’s County Police Department’s Homicide Unit identified and charged a man in connection with a double fatal shooting on Friday night. The suspect is 31-year-old Marc Carter of Temple Hills. He is charged with the murder of 32-year-old Antonio Magruder of District Heights and 56-year-old Darrell Mason of Suitland.
On March 28, 2025, at approximately 10:30 pm, officers responded to a shooting in the 4000 block of Silver Hill Road. Officers located Magruder inside of a business suffering from a gunshot wound. He was pronounced dead on the scene. Mason was located inside of a vehicle suffering from a gunshot wound. He died a short time later at a hospital. A third man was also shot. His injuries are not considered life-threatening.
The motive for the shooting remains under investigation. The preliminary investigation revealed Carter was known to one of the victims.
Carter is charged with two counts of first and second degree murder and several additional charges. He is in the custody of the Department of Corrections on a no-bond status.
